Short Term Parking at MRY sits a 1–3 minute walk from the terminal, so you’re not paying Premium rates just to be at the front curb. It’s a short-stay setup, suited to day trips, quick business overnights, or picking someone up when you want to park instead of circling the loop.
Rates run up to a $30.00 maximum per 24 hours, billed as a standard short-term lot rather than hourly street pricing. For most same-day runs, you’ll land under that cap, but the ceiling matters if your meeting runs long and you roll into a second calendar day.
The standout detail here: this is the only MRY lot with a published disabled parking discount. Vehicles with a Disabled Person plate or DP placard get a reduced handicap rate that caps at $18 per 24 hours instead of the usual $30. The airport spells out that this discount lives in Short Term only.
Important fine print: that disabled discount does not apply in Long Term or in Short Term (Premium); the airport site calls out Short Term by name in the policy. If you qualify, skip the other lots and head straight to this one to lock in the $18 handicap daily maximum.
There aren’t widespread complaints about this lot online, and with such a short 3-minute walk, traffic around the terminal loop is usually a bigger time variable than the walk itself. The trade: slightly farther from the doors than Short Term (Premium), but a meaningfully lower daily cost ceiling.
Tip: If you use a DP plate or placard, park only in the signed Short Term Parking area and confirm the $18 handicap daily rate on the pay machine or posted board before you leave the car.
